Course Description
The Geophysics offers both traditional, research-oriented graduate programs and non-thesis education programs designed to meet specific career objectives. The program of study is selected by the student, in consultation with an advisor, and with thesis committee approval, according to the student’s career needs and interests.
The Geophysics Concentration combines a strong foundation in geology with additional depth in geophysics, physics, mathematics, and associated quantitative and computer skills. Students in this concentration are well prepared both for employment opportunities in a wide variety of geosciences and geotechnical fields, and for subsequent graduate training that includes geophysics, seismology, geodynamics, energy exploration, environmental geophysics, space sciences, and resource management.
The geophysics Ph.D. course requirements, residency requirements, and the requirements for the Comprehensive Examination are formulated within the regulations of the Graduate School. In case of a conflict between those documents and the requirements stated here, the rules of the Graduate School apply. A core of graduate courses, included in the minimum of 30 semester hours required for all Ph.D. is specified for students completing the Ph.D. in geophysics. This core coursework is designed to assure competency in appropriate subject matter at the Ph.D. level.
